With the CHANNEL SET UP menu open:
Press ♦ or ♦ to access a feature, then press ^.
CABLE: Select ON if your TV is connected to a cable
system.
CHANNEL FIX: Press ♦ or ♦ to set the TV's input to one

of the following options:
2-6: When a cable box is connected to the VHF/UHF input. Press DBS/CABLE
(FUNCTION) and then CH +/- to change channels through your cable box.
AUX 2-6: When a cable box is connected to AUX and a cable or antenna is
connected to VHF/UHF. You can alternate between the two Inputs by pressing
ANT on the remote control. (KV-32S65, 32V65, 35S65, 35V65 only)
VIDEO 1: When you have connected video equipment (e.g. /W receiver) and
you want the TV input fixed to it. You will be able to alternate between video
sources using the A/V receiver.
OFF: When you want to turn CHANNEL FIX off.

AUTO PROGRAM: Instructs the TV to program all receivable channels.
